Output f7f143920437500c8d6623b830f17e25099cd9f2ac4013f20a66b768312b9a2d:0

value
38167730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c1e1e0e8076cdbe995479a2054ed19e1fcd7add OP_EQUAL
address
3Qg6HUkWSuSfWjzP2nBi1HsJaseEVeCF94
transaction
f7f143920437500c8d6623b830f17e25099cd9f2ac4013f20a66b768312b9a2d
confirmations
366214
spent
true